AMS2 looks great and has some really cool historical content, but whether the AI does a decent job or not is very dependant on the car/track combination you choose since it doesn't run on the same physics you have (which gets revamped every update) and it needs to be manually tuned by the developer for each straight/corner.
Also, the developer keeps adding more series instead of focusing on fleshing out the carset, AI and rulesets for those already in the game.
The game can do vintage open wheelers, Kart, GT3, multi-class IMSA, Nascar/Indy ovals, Rallycross, 90s DTM, Stadium Super Trucks and pretty much every everything else except actual rally...
It just doesn't do a great job for ANY of this stuff (while lacking official licenses on top of course).

EVO still feels like it's in an alpha stage, with each update taking months and mostly just adding an handful of cars plus one or two tracks.
The car simulation is fine and you can hotlap some cool tracks or do a track day on the Nordschleife online, but that's mostly it for the fun stuff.
Modded AC already does everything EVO can and more.

>>736633097
yeah it's wild
for those who don't know, Ian Bell, who is the head of Straight studios and previously Slightly Mad Studios, once worked for Simbin, the company that produced GTR2 and the WTCC Race games.
Allegedly at some point he made off with the source code to ISI's gmotor/pmotor game engine which is the underlying technology behind rfactor 1 and 2, ams1, and lemans ultimate (among others).
rumors allege that SMS' Madness engine used by the Project CARS games, AMS2 and Project Motor Racing is based on, in whole or in part, this stolen source code.

>>736636918
that's not quite right
a 911 understeers under power because the engine, all the mass of the car, is in the back. To corner appropriately in a 911 you have to brake gently to get the weight transferred forward, then you can turn hard because the front end doesn't have a big massive engine to generate a whole lot of inertia. This makes the car start to oversteer which you then control by getting back on the gas and making that fat ass squat which makes the car stop oversteering and go where it is pointed. Driving a 911 is exactly like driving a racing go-kart where you are balancing brake and throttle to corner effectively rather than using only one pedal at a time.
